Footy's Untouchable Players Post by: Triple M Footy 5 November, 2009 - 9:07 AM

In the next three seasons the new Gold Coast and Western Sydney team will have a free grab at your clubs best players.

The AFL has agreed that the new teams will get an advantage in the first pick drafts as well as the chance to pick up uncontracted players that want to go.

It's a horrible to think any of your best young brigade that you've spent years moulding into your team could get snapped up by these new interstate teams. We want you to pick a player that would be the last player that you would be prepared to give up.

Race Driver Mark Skaife reckons Scott Pendlebury is the one player that Collingwood should hang on to.
